Well, I'm having something done about it... :)
I should actually get my boat back today from a shop that was doing some other cosmetic stuff for me... I asked them to look under the bench seats in the cuddy and they found them to be relatively open. They applied some white gel coat to the surfaces in there and put some 1"x1" strips on the bottom of the (seat) cushion so that they will 'lock' into place (once put back into place and under the 'back' cushion...) I'll snap some pics and post them up once I have it back! - justin |

Finally remembered to snap some pics of my cuddy this weekend... sorry for the delay!
I do think they could have made the openings a little bigger, while still supporting the cushion enough, and maybe I'll have them go back and enlarge them the next time the boat is in the shop... We shall see. As of right now, I only have the large bumpers (8.5" I think?? they are huge) and I have one-each sitting up behind the back rest of the bench seats down below... The holes cut out right now are not big enough for the bumpers, but perhaps a smaller one... otherwise, they are great for spare parts, rags, etc etc... (the one white bumper is not one of my regular bumpers - those are much bigger - the white one is just a spare I found floating in the river one day) https://lh3.googleusercontent.com/-T...G_00001512.jpg https://lh6.googleusercontent.com/-r...G_00001513.jpg https://lh5.googleusercontent.com/-s...G_00001515.jpg https://lh3.googleusercontent.com/-0...G_00001517.jpg https://lh4.googleusercontent.com/-F...G_00001518.jpg You can see that they simply attached some 6"-8" strips of hard plastic (I forget what he called it) that will keep the cushion from sliding forward while you're sitting on it. And the back rest cushion holds everything else in place enough that I've never had them come off - even in very rough water! |
